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to the field of cigarette capsule technology, and in particular to a stor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ette capsule and its preparation method. Background Technology

[0002] Cigarette flavor capsules, also known as flavored capsules, are widely used in the daily chemical, food, and tobacco industries due to their stable aroma, high flavor capacity, versatility, personalization, and ability to enhance smoothness. The design concept of cigarette flavor capsules involves embedding small beads filled with different flavoring liquids within the cigarette. Users can easily squeeze the beads while smoking to burst them, releasing a variety of aromas and flavors. This unique experience not only increases the enjoyment of smoking but also satisfies modern consumers' demands for personalization and diversity.

[0003] However, cigarette flavor capsules are usually made of relatively thin plastic or other lightweight materials, which are prone to losing their toughness when temperature and humidity change, leading to breakage. In addition, due to the poor strength of cigarette flavor capsules themselves, improper storage conditions, such as high temperature, high humidity, or improper stacking, may cause premature breakage of the capsules.

[0004] Regarding the aforementioned technologies, the inventors discovered that existing tobacco flavor capsule materials have poor strength and are prone to breakage during production, processing, and transportation. Summary of the Invention

[0005] In order to improve the defects of existing cigarette flavoring beads that are not durable and easily break, this application provides a storage-resistant and breakage-resistant cigarette flavoring bead and its preparation method.

[0006] In a first aspect, this application provides a stor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ette flavoring bead, employing the following technical solution: A stor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ette capsule includes a wall material and a core material, wherein the core material is an essential oil, and the wall material comprises the following substances in parts by weight: Mix 70-80 parts of adhesive powder; Improver 0.5-10 parts; 0.5-3.0 parts of skeleton filling material; The mixed adhesive powder includes at least three of the following: carrageenan, gellan gum, gelatin, and instant agar.

[0007] Through the above technical solutions, this application optimizes the stor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ette flavor capsules through special wall and core material components. The wall material comprises mixed adhesive powder, modifiers, and skeleton filler materials, making the flavor capsules less prone to breakage under stress. In particular, the mixed use of carrageenan, gellan gum, gelatin, and instant agar enhances the elasticity and toughness of the wall material while maintaining good fluidity, ensuring the stability of the flavor capsules during storage and transportation. Furthermore, the selection of essential oil core materials not only improves the taste experience of cigarettes but also extends the product's shelf life to a certain extent.

[0008] Furthermore, the skeleton filling material is cellulose nanocrystals.

[0009] Through the above technical solution, this application introduces cellulose nanocrystals as a skeleton filler material, significantly improving the structural strength and anti-breakage performance of the burst beads. Cellulose nanocrystals possess excellent mechanical properties and a high specific surface area; their addition can enhance the toughness and durability of the wall material, reducing the risk of breakage under external impact. Simultaneously, due to the natural source of cellulose, this material also has advantages in terms of biocompatibility and environmental friendliness.

[0010] Furthermore, the cellulose nanocrystals are provided with a supporting matrix, which is a chitosan gel solution.

[0011] Through the above technical solution, this application utilizes chitosan gel as a loading matrix, which helps to further improve the stability and functionality of cellulose nanocrystals. Chitosan, as a natural polysaccharide, provides an additional protective layer for cigarette-grade capsules while improving the dispersion performance of cellulose nanocrystals within the wall material, thereby resulting in a uniform wall material structure with good mechanical properties and strength.

[0012] Furthermore, the modifier includes an inorganic framework modifier, and the inorganic curing modifier is nano-titanium dioxide particles.

[0013] Through the above technical solution, this application further adds an inorganic framework modifier (nano-titanium dioxide particles) to improve the mechanical properties and oxidation resistance of the wall material. By combining inorganic and organic materials in the structure, the mechanical strength and properties of the wall material structure can be further improved, thereby enhancing its crack resistance.

[0014] Furthermore, the wall material is also provided with a reinforcing layer, which is a polysaccharide reinforcing coating layer covering the surface of the wall material.

[0015] Furthermore, the polysaccharide-enhanced coating layer is formed by coating with a pol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ution, which comprises the following substances in parts by weight: 30-45 parts inulin; 0.5-1.0 parts of calcium chloride; 80-120 parts water.

[0016] Through the above technical solution, this application further enhances the anti-breakage performance and storage stability of the bursting beads by designing a reinforcing layer. The polysaccharide coating not only provides additional physical protection but may also increase the lubricity of the bursting beads, making it easier to control force during extrusion and reducing the risk of breakage. Simultaneously, the mixed gel structure and inulin undergo localized interactions at the edges of the bonding zone, such as hydrogen bonds and hydrophobic bonds, thereby forming a highly cross-linked gel network with a reinforced structure. Through changes in the microstructure of the mixed gel, inulin, and calcium chloride, the mechanical properties and strength of the wall material are further improved.

[0017] Secondly, this application provides a method for preparing stor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ette flavoring beads, employing the following technical solution: A method for preparing a stor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ette flavoring capsule includes the following preparation steps: Mix the mixed adhesive powder with deionized water and stir, then collect the mixture. The mixture is placed in a heating device, heated and kept at a constant temperature to treat the adhesive, and the mixed adhesive solution is collected. Take the mixed adhesive solution and place it in a heating device to adjust the viscosity. Stir and test the viscosity until it is appropriate. Then place it in an oil bath heating device, evacuate the air and let it stand for later use. The flavoring used in the tobacco is mixed with liquid paraffin, the liquid core material is collected and cooled; A dropper device is used to add the wall material solution dropwise into the cooled core material liquid under pressure, and the wet pellets are collected. The wet pellets are immersed in a pol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ution. After immersion, they are washed, dried, balanced, and sieved to prepare storage-resistant and shatter-resistant tobacco capsules.

[0018] Furthermore, the temperature of the gelling treatment is 50-60℃.

[0019] Furthermore, the viscosity of the viscosity-adjusting treatment is 880-920 MPa·s.

[0020] Furthermore, the cooling temperature is 10-15℃.

[0021] Through the above technical solutions, this application optimizes the preparation parameters of the bursting bead material. By adjusting the viscosity range and improving the cooling temperature, the processing performance of the product is improved, and it also helps to prevent cracking during use. At the same time, optimizing the cooling temperature further promotes the solidification and curing of the wall material, ensuring the stability of the bursting bead morphology. This reduces the fluidity of the material at lower temperatures, which helps to form a more robust structure and reduces the risk of breakage caused by external stress.

[0026] The present application will be further described in detail below with reference to the embodiments.

[0027] The raw materials and instruments used in this embodiment are shown below, but are not limited thereto. Unless otherwise specified, the raw materials used are of analytical grade.

[0028] Preparation Example 1 Mixed adhesive powder 1 Take 500-550g of carrageenan, 500-550g of instant agar, and 400-450g of gellan gum, stir and mix them, and collect the mixed gum powder 1.

[0029] Preparation Example 2 Take 500-550g of gelatin, 500-550g of instant agar, and 400-450g of gellan gum, stir and mix them, and collect the mixed gelatin powder 2.

[0030] Preparation Example 3 Take 200-250g of gelatin, 250-350g of carrageenan, 500-550g of instant agar and 400-450g of gellan gum, stir and mix them, and collect the mixed gum powder 3.

[0031] Preparation Example 4 Framework filling material 1: cellulose nanocrystals.

[0032] Preparation Example 5 Framework filling material 2: Take 2g of cellulose nanocrystals and 10g of chitosan, stir and mix them, and collect the framework filling material 2.

[0033] Preparation Example 6 Pol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 1 Take 300g of inulin, 5g of calcium chloride and 800g of water and stir to mix them to collect pol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 1.

[0034] Preparation Example 7 Pol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 2 Take 375g of inulin, 8g of calcium chloride and 1000g of water and stir to mix, and collect pol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 2.

[0035] Preparation Example 9 Pol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 3 Take 450g of inulin, 10g of calcium chloride and 1200g of water and stir to mix them to collect polysaccharide-enhanced coating solution 3. Example 1

[0036] A stor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ette capsule comprises 70 kg of mixed adhesive powder 1, 0.5 kg of modifier nano-titanium dioxide particles and 0.5 kg of skeleton filler material 1.

[0037] A method for preparing a stor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ette flavoring capsule includes the following preparation steps: Take 70 kg of mixed adhesive powder 1 and mix it with deionized water at a mass ratio of 1:30, and collect the mixture. The mixture is placed in a heating device and heated to 50°C. The mixture is then kept at this temperature to allow it to gel, and the gel mixture is collected. Take the mixed adhesive solution and place it in a heating device to adjust the viscosity to 880 MPa·s. Stir and check the viscosity until it is appropriate. Then place it in an 85℃ oil bath heating device, evacuate the air and let it stand for later use. Mix peppermint essence with liquid paraffin at a mass ratio of 1:25, collect the core material liquid and cool it at 10°C. By using a pellet dropping device to drop a wall material solution onto a cooled core material liquid under pressure, collecting the wet pellets, washing them with water, drying them to achieve equilibrium, and then sieving them, a storage-resistant and shatter-resistant type of cigarette-grade capsules can be prepared. [0054] Performance testing

[0055] The storage-resistant and shatter-resistant tobacco capsules prepared in Examples 1-9 were subjected to performance tests, specifically testing their appearance, hardness, and storage stability.

[0056] Appearance: Use a beaker to collect an appropriate amount of wet capsules and observe the appearance of the capsules on the inspection table.

[0057] Hardness: Measured using a CTS-II type tobacco capsule comprehensive tester.

[0058] Storage stability: The capsules are packaged and stored in the warehouse. The appearance and quality of the capsules are regularly sampled and inspected. The warehouse environment is 22℃ and 50% humidity.

[0059] The results are shown in Table 1 below: Table 1 Performance Test Table Example 1 Good appearance 15.87 No leakage Example 2 Good appearance 16.87 No leakage Example 3 Good appearance 16.23 No leakage Example 4 Good appearance 16.18 No leakage Example 5 Good appearance 16.05 No leakage Example 6 Good appearance 16.85 No leakage Example 7 Good appearance 17.05 No leakage Example 8 Good appearance 17.59 No leakage Example 9 Good appearance 17.21 No leakage From the above examples 1-9, and by comparing the test results in Table 1, it can be found that: Performance tests conducted on Examples 1-6 show that this application optimizes the storage-resistant and shatter-resistant cigarette capsules through special wall and core material components. The wall material comprises mixed adhesive powder, modifiers, and a skeleton filler, making the capsules less prone to shattering under stress. Simultaneously, this application introduces cellulose nanocrystals as a skeleton filler, significantly improving the structural strength and shatter resistance of the capsules. Cellulose nanocrystals possess excellent mechanical properties and a high specific surface area; their addition enhances the toughness and durability of the wall material, reducing the risk of breakage under external impact. Furthermore, due to the natural source of cellulose, this material also offers advantages in biocompatibility and environmental friendliness.

[0060] A comparison of Examples 1-6 and Examples 7-9 further illustrates that the design of the reinforcing layer enhances the bursting resistance and storage stability of the bursting beads. The polysaccharide coating not only provides additional physical protection but may also increase the lubricity of the bursting beads, making it easier to control force during extrusion and reducing the risk of breakage. Simultaneously, the mixed gel structure and inulin undergo localized interactions at the edges of the bonding zone, such as hydrogen bonds and hydrophobic bonds, thereby forming a highly cross-linked gel network with a reinforced structure. Through changes in the microstructure of the mixed gel, inulin, and calcium chloride, the mechanical properties and strength of the wall material are further improved.
